The Benefits of Massage Therapy


Massage therapy is more than just a way to relax. It has several benefits that can improve both your physical and mental health. Here are some key advantages:


  • Reduces Stress: One of the most immediate benefits of massage is its ability to reduce stress. The soothing touch of a skilled therapist can help lower cortisol levels, which are often elevated during stressful times.


  • Alleviates Pain: Whether you suffer from chronic pain or occasional discomfort, massage can provide relief. Techniques like deep tissue massage target specific areas of tension, helping to ease muscle soreness and stiffness.


  • Improves Circulation: Massage promotes better blood flow, which can enhance the delivery of oxygen and nutrients to your muscles and organs. Improved circulation can lead to better overall health.


  • Enhances Flexibility: Regular massage can help improve your flexibility and range of motion. This is especially beneficial for athletes or anyone who engages in physical activity.


  • Boosts Mood: Massage therapy can also have a positive impact on your mental health. It can help reduce anxiety and depression, leaving you feeling more relaxed and uplifted.


Each of these benefits contributes to a more balanced and healthy lifestyle.


Types of Massage Therapy


There are various types of massage therapy, each designed to address different needs and preferences. Here are some popular options:


  • Swedish Massage: This is one of the most common types of massage. It uses long, flowing strokes to promote relaxation and improve circulation. It is ideal for those new to massage therapy.


  • Deep Tissue Massage: This technique focuses on deeper layers of muscle and connective tissue. It is particularly effective for chronic pain and tension.


  • Sports Massage: Designed for athletes, this type of massage helps prevent injuries and improve performance. It can be tailored to the specific needs of the individual.


  • Hot Stone Massage: This therapy uses heated stones placed on specific points of the body. The warmth helps to relax muscles and enhance the overall experience.


  • Aromatherapy Massage: This combines the benefits of massage with essential oils. Different oils can be used to promote relaxation, energy, or healing.


Choosing the right type of massage depends on your personal preferences and specific needs.


What to Expect During a Massage Session


If you are new to massage therapy, you may wonder what to expect during your first session. Here is a step-by-step guide:


  1. Consultation: Before the massage begins, your therapist will ask about your health history and any specific areas of concern. This helps them tailor the session to your needs.


  2. Setting the Atmosphere: The massage room will typically be dimly lit and quiet, creating a calming environment. Soft music may be playing in the background.


  3. Draping: You will be asked to undress to your comfort level. A sheet or towel will be used to cover you, ensuring your privacy while allowing access to the areas being treated.


  4. The Massage: The therapist will use various techniques based on the type of massage you chose. You can communicate with them about pressure and comfort levels throughout the session.


  5. Post-Massage Care: After the massage, your therapist may provide recommendations for aftercare, such as hydration or stretches to enhance the benefits of the session.


Understanding what to expect can help ease any anxiety you may have about your first massage experience.


How Often Should You Get a Massage?


The frequency of massage therapy can vary based on individual needs and lifestyle. Here are some general guidelines:


  • For Stress Relief: If you are seeking massage primarily for stress relief, a monthly session may be sufficient.


  • For Chronic Pain: Those dealing with chronic pain may benefit from weekly or bi-weekly sessions to manage symptoms effectively.


  • For Athletes: Athletes often schedule massages more frequently, especially during training or competition seasons. Regular sessions can help prevent injuries and enhance performance.


Ultimately, the best frequency for you will depend on your personal goals and how your body responds to massage therapy.

Finding the Right Massage Therapist


Choosing the right massage therapist is crucial for a positive experience. Here are some tips to help you find the right fit:


  • Check Credentials: Ensure that the therapist is licensed and has the necessary training. This can give you peace of mind about their skills.


  • Read Reviews: Look for reviews or testimonials from previous clients. This can provide insight into their experience and expertise.


  • Ask Questions: Don’t hesitate to ask questions during your consultation. A good therapist will be happy to address your concerns and explain their techniques.


  • Trust Your Instincts: Ultimately, trust your instincts. You should feel comfortable and safe with your therapist.


Finding the right therapist can make all the difference in your massage experience.
